草庐IT

matlab-coder

全部标签

matlab怎么搭建神经网络,matlab实现神经网络算法

怎样用matlab建立bp神经网络net=train(net,p,t);把这句改成net=train(net,p',t');试试,matlab应该默认使用列向量。或者直接使用matlab提供的图形界面取训练,在命令行输入nnstart。谷歌人工智能写作项目:神经网络伪原创如何用matlab构建一个三层bp神经网络模型,用于预测温度。第0节、引例本文以Fisher的Iris数据集作为神经网络程序的测试数据集写作猫。Iris数据集可以在找到。这里简要介绍一下Iris数据集:有一批Iris花,已知这批Iris花可分为3个品种,现需要对其进行分类。不同品种的Iris花的花萼长度、花萼宽度、花瓣长度、花

【MATLAB GUI】导入音频

一、相关函数1、uigetfile函数——标准化打开选择文件对话框使用形式:[filename,pname]=uigetfile('.wav','选择音频文件');解释:[返回的文件名,返回文件的路径名]'选择的文件类型'%多个文件类型用{}引住'选择音频文件'%打开对话框的标题2、audioread函数[y,fs]=audioread(filename);%y为保存的音频数据3、sound函数sound(y);%默认采样率8192Hz向扬声器发送音频信号sound(y,fs);%以采样率fs发送采样信号sound(y,fs,nbit);%对音频信号y使用nbit的采样率;nbit表示每个样本

“华为杯”研究生数学建模竞赛2006年-【华为杯】C题:维修线性流量阀时的内筒设计问题(附获奖论文及matlab代码)

赛题描述油田采油用的油井都是先用钻机钻几千米深的孔后,再利用固井机向四周的孔壁喷射水泥砂浆得到水泥井管后形成的。固井机上用来控制砂浆流量的阀是影响水泥井管质量的关键部件,但也会因磨损而损坏。目前我国还不能生产完整的阀体,固井机仍依赖进口。由于损坏的内筒已经被磨损得面目全非,根本无法测绘出原来的形状,因此维修时只能根据工作原理并结合阀的结构进行设计。根据仪表刻度可知控制流量的阀是一个线性阀,即阀体的旋转角度与砂浆流量成正比。在设计分析中假设砂浆的压力恒定,进而流量与“过流面积“(严格定义见下文)成正比,因此阀体的旋转角度应该与“过流面积“成正比。一般来讲,控制流量的阀体为两个同心圆柱筒(两筒直径

数学建模代码速成~赛前一个月~matlab~代码模板~吐血总结~三大模型代码(预测模型、优化模型、评价模型)

目录 一.预测模型1.BP神经网络预测2.灰色预测3.拟合插值预测(线性回归)4.时间序列预测5.马尔科夫链预测6.微分方程预测7.Logistic模型二.优化模型1.规划模型(目标规划、线性规划、非线性规划、整数规划、动态规划)2.图论模型3.排队论模型4.神经网络模型5.现代优化算法(遗传算法、模拟退火算法、蚁群算法、禁忌搜索算法)三.评价模型1.模糊综合评价法3.聚类分析法4.主成分分析评价法5.灰色综合评价法6.人工神经网络评价法 更多详细代码+案例:http://www.hedaoapp.com/goods/goodsDetails?pid=4131 一.预测模型1.BP神经网络预测

毕业设计-基于 MATLAB 的图像去雾技术研究

目录前言课题背景和意义实现技术思路一、常用图像去雾算法 二、基于MATLAB的图像去雾系统 三、图像质量评价部分源代码实现效果图样例最后前言  📅大四是整个大学期间最忙碌的时光,一边要忙着备考或实习为毕业后面临的就业升学做准备,一边要为毕业设计耗费大量精力。近几年各个学校要求的毕设项目越来越难,有不少课题是研究生级别难度的,对本科同学来说是充满挑战。为帮助大家顺利通过和节省时间与精力投入到更重要的就业和考试中去,学长分享优质的选题经验和毕设项目与技术思路。🚀对毕设有任何疑问都可以问学长哦!选题指导: https://blog.csdn.net/qq_37340229/article/detai

通信原理与MATLAB(七):2FSK的调制解调

目录1.2FSK的调制原理2.2FSK的解调原理3.2FSK的代码4.结果图5.特点6.代码改进7.BFSK误码率曲线8.BFSK改进代码1.2FSK的调制原理2FSK调制原理如下图所示,基带码元d(t)中码元为1时,波形为频率为f1的高频载波;基带码元d(t)中码元为0时,波形为频率为f2的高频载波实现2FSK信号的调制,即基带码元和f1的高频正弦波相乘生成2ASK,基带码元的反码和f2的高频正弦波相乘生成第二个2ASK,两个2ASK相加得到2FSK。波形图如下图所示2.2FSK的解调原理2FSK的解调原理如下图所示,2FSK信号经过信道传输之后,分为上下两路经过带通滤波器变成两路2ASK信

vivado&matlab图像算法仿真

1介绍fpga实现图像算法处理模块,应先进行模块仿真,仿真时会用到txt文件作为数据转存介质,图像输入源来自txt文件,fpga处理后得到的图像数据保存到txt。matlab将待处理图像转存成txt文件,将fpga处理的图像txt文件恢复成图片,便于观看;matlab也可以进行算法设计仿真。2功能matlab实现图像与txt之间转换,包括读写txt,读写显示图片。matlab实现图像算法设计。vivado进行fpga图像处理模块testbench编写和行为仿真。3仿真步骤a)matlab将待处理图像保存为txt文件b)vivado上撰写testbench进行图像仿真c)matlab将vivad

MATLAB 之 绘制三维图形的基本函数、三维曲面和其他三维图形

文章目录一、绘制三维曲线的基本函数二、三维曲面1.平面网格坐标矩阵的生成2.绘制三维曲面的函数3.标准三维曲面三、其他三维图形1.三维条形图2.三维饼图3.三维实心图4.三维散点图5.三维杆图6.三维箭头图三维图形具有更强的数据表现能力,为此MATLAB提供了丰富的函数来绘制三维图形。绘制三维图形与绘制二维图形的方法十分类似,很多都是在二维绘图的基础上扩展而来。一、绘制三维曲线的基本函数基本的三维图形函数为plot3,它是将二维绘图函数plot的有关功能扩展到三维空间,用来绘制三维曲线。plot3函数与plot函数用法十分相似,其调用格式如下:plot3(x1,y1,z1,选项1,x2,y2,

MATLAB的Viewer3D工具箱引入及使用方式

目录一、工具箱的导入二、工具箱的使用方法由于MATLAB没有直接给出重建后的三维图像进行展示的方式,因此需要借助工具箱Viewer3D来辅助完成展示的工作,以下是工具箱的导入和使用方法,希望对大家有帮助。一、工具箱的导入1、打开MATLAB,点击主页,找到附加功能2、 点击附加功能,搜索需要导入的工具箱viewer3d3、选择第一个,然后点击右上角的添加,选择下载并添加到路径,等待下载完成即可。 4、如果需要使用这个工具箱,可以在使用viewer(V_exact),对三维物体V_exact进行展示。二、工具箱的使用方法 1、在执行viewer(V_exact)命令后,会出现一个窗口,如下所示:

matlab基础(一):matlab中矩阵的基本运算

    在学习矩阵有关运算的时候要相信自己已经知道了很多线代知识,不然会看不懂的QAQ~ 1.关于矩阵的一些基本运算函数: 例1:生成一个3阶全1矩阵。>>ones(3)ans=111111111例2:产生一个在区间[5,15]内均匀分布的5阶随机矩阵>>a=5;b=15;>>x=a+-(b-a)*rand(5)x=4.02463.42393.5811-1.5574-2.57742.2150-4.70590.78244.6429-2.4313-0.4688-4.5717-4.1574-3.49131.0777-4.57510.1462-2.9221-4.3399-1.5548-4.6489-3